The PN1-NT is a tenor guitar with the tried-and-true combo of spruce top and mahogany back and sides. Herringbone purfling and a classic mosaic soundhole rosette give it a much more professional appearance than the price-tag implies.
Body
Body type: Parlor
Cutaway: No
Top wood: Spruce
Back & sides: Mahogany
Bracing pattern: X
Body finish: Natural High Gloss
Neck
Neck shape: U
Nut width: 42mm
Fingerboard: Rosewood
Neck wood: Mahogany
Scale length: 620mm (24.4)
Number of frets: 18
Neck finish: Satin
Electronics Pickup/preamp: No
Other
Headstock overlay: Rosewood
Tuning machines: Open-Gear
Bridge: Rosewood
Saddle & nut: Plastic
Number of strings: 6
Special features: Ibanez Advantage Bridge Pins, Herringbone Purfling,
Case: Sold separately
Accessories: N/A
Country of origin: China

.I've been looking for a nice inexpensive parlor guitar to add to my collection and I decided to purchase this one. It is very well built and plays very well. But what was most impressive is the tone and volume. The sound is very even across the strings and this thing is loud. It doesn't sound boxy like most small guitars which was a surprise. No doubt this is due to the spruce top. The finish is also flawless. It also came triple boxed and was one of the best packaging I've seen for a guitar.
I changed to lighter strings (10's) and had to shim the bridge on the bass side. It comes with an extra bridge so I will use it later, but for now it's fine. I didn't take a star away because I did change the strings. I also made a piezo pickup and placed a ¼" endpin jack for it and it sounds great out of my acoustic amp. The truss rod adjustment is at the heel of the neck inside the sound hole. I purchased a Gator GBE-Mini-Acou Gig Bag (SKU 546040) and it fits like it was made for it.
This is one of the best purchases I've made in years and if you're in the market for a nice parlor guitar don't overlook this one. It's a keeper.
